Understanding the Role of Paver Sealers

Paver sealers play an essential role in protecting your paved surfaces from the elements and daily wear and tear. After a thorough cleaning with power washing supplies, applying a high-quality paver sealer can:

  • Enhance Aesthetic Appeal: A good sealer will bring out the natural colors of the pavers, making your outdoor space more vibrant.
  • Prevent Stains: Sealers create a barrier that helps resist spills, dirt, and other contaminants from penetrating the surface.
  • Reduce Weed Growth: By filling in the joints between pavers, sealers can minimize the chances of weeds breaking through.
  • Increase Lifespan: Proper sealing can extend the life of your pavers, saving you from costly repairs or replacements.

Types of Paver Sealers

Before diving into the specifics of choosing a paver sealer, it's essential to understand the different types available on the market. Each type has its unique properties and benefits:

1. Acrylic Sealers

Acrylic sealers are one of the most popular choices due to their ease of application and versatility. They form a protective film on the surface of the pavers, which enhances color while providing water resistance. However, they may require reapplication every 1-3 years, depending on weather conditions.

2. Polyurethane Sealers

Polyurethane sealers offer superior protection and durability, making them ideal for high-traffic areas. They are more resistant to scratches and UV rays than acrylic options but can be more challenging to apply due to their thicker consistency.

3. Epoxy Sealers

Epoxy sealers provide the toughest protection and are especially suitable for commercial applications. They create a hard, glossy finish that is resistant to chemicals and stains. However, they are also the most difficult to apply and may require professional installation.

4. Natural Stone Sealers

If you have natural stone pavers, it's crucial to select a sealer specifically designed for this material. These sealers penetrate deeply into the stone, protecting it from moisture and staining while allowing it to breathe.

Factors to Consider When Choosing a Paver Sealer

Selecting the right paver sealer involves several considerations to ensure you achieve the best results for your surfaces:

1. Surface Type

The type of surface you are sealing significantly influences your choice of sealer. For example, natural stone pavers require a penetrating sealer, while concrete pavers may work well with topical sealers.

2. Desired Finish

Consider the finish you want for your paved surfaces. Sealers can provide different finishes, from matte to glossy. A high-gloss finish can enhance colors but may also make the surface slippery when wet.

3. Weather Conditions

Evaluate the climate in your area. If you live in an area with heavy rainfall, a water-resistant sealer will be essential. For hot climates, UV protection can prevent fading.

4. Application Method

Think about how you want to apply the sealer. Some products can be applied with a roller or sprayer, while others may require professional equipment or techniques, especially for larger areas.

The Importance of Power Washing Before Sealing

Power washing is a critical step that should never be overlooked before applying a paver sealer. The process not only removes dirt and grime but also prepares the surface for optimal adhesion of the sealer. Here’s why:

  • Removes Contaminants: Oil stains, algae, and dirt can hinder the effectiveness of the sealer.
  • Prepares the Surface: A clean surface allows for better penetration and bonding of the sealer, ensuring longer-lasting results.
  • Improves Appearance: Power washing restores the original color of the pavers, making the sealing process more effective.

How to Apply Paver Sealers

Once you’ve selected the right paver sealer and completed your power washing, it’s time to apply the product. Follow these steps for optimal results:

  1. Choose a Suitable Day: Ideal conditions for applying a sealer are a dry day without extreme temperatures or direct sunlight.
  2. Prepare the Area: Ensure all furniture and debris are removed from the area. You may want to use painter's tape to protect adjacent surfaces.
  3. Mix the Sealer: Follow the manufacturer's instructions for mixing the sealer if necessary.
  4. Apply Evenly: Use a roller or sprayer to apply the sealer evenly, ensuring you cover all areas. Avoid puddling.
  5. Allow to Dry: Let the sealer dry completely as per the manufacturer’s guidelines before walking on the surface.

Maintaining Sealed Pavers

After applying a paver sealer, maintaining the surfaces is crucial to prolonging their effectiveness. Here are some tips:

  • Regular Cleaning: Use a gentle cleaner and avoid harsh chemicals that can degrade the sealer.
  • Inspect for Damage: Regularly check for signs of wear or damage, especially in high-traffic areas.
  • Reapply as Needed: Depending on the type of sealer used, you may need to reapply every few years to ensure ongoing protection.
